No More Worries!


Our orders are delivered strictly on time without delay

Paper Formatting

  • Double or single-spaced
  • 1-inch margin
  • 12 Font Arial or Times New Roman
  • 300 words per page

No Lateness!

image Our orders are delivered strictly on time without delay

AEW Guarantees

image

  • Free Unlimited revisions
  • Guaranteed Privacy
  • Money Return guarantee
  • Plagiarism Free Writing

Sample Answer

Understanding the Diffie-Hellman Protocol and its Purpose
The Diffie-Hellman (DH) protocol is a key exchange algorithm that allows two parties to securely establish a shared secret key over an insecure communication channel. It was invented by Whitfield Diffie and Martin Hellman in 1976 and has since become a fundamental component of modern cryptographic systems. This essay will explore the purpose of the Diffie-Hellman protocol, explain how it works by describing the Diffie-Hellman function and the discrete logarithm problem, and highlight the main difference between the RSA and Diffie-Hellman protocols.

The primary purpose of the Diffie-Hellman protocol is to establish a shared secret key between two parties without needing to transmit the key itself over an insecure channel. This is accomplished by exploiting the mathematical properties of modular exponentiation and the difficulty of solving the discrete logarithm problem.

The Diffie-Hellman protocol works as follows:

Firstly, both parties agree on a large prime number, p, and a primitive root modulo p, g. These values are publicly known.

Each party, let’s say Alice and Bob, chooses a private random number, a for Alice and b for Bob. These private numbers are kept secret.

Alice computes A = g^a mod p, while Bob computes B = g^b mod p. They exchange these computed values.

Alice receives B from Bob, and Bob receives A from Alice.

Now, both Alice and Bob independently compute the shared secret key using their private numbers and the received values. Alice calculates s = B^a mod p, while Bob calculates s = A^b mod p.

Remarkably, both Alice and Bob end up with the same shared secret key, s, without ever transmitting it over the insecure channel.

The security of the Diffie-Hellman protocol relies on the computational infeasibility of solving the discrete logarithm problem. This problem refers to the difficulty of finding the exponent when given the base, modulus, and result of modular exponentiation. In other words, it is challenging to determine a or b from A or B in the equation A = g^a mod p or B = g^b mod p, respectively.

Now, let’s compare the main difference between the RSA and Diffie-Hellman protocols:

The primary distinction lies in their applications within cryptographic systems. The Diffie-Hellman protocol is used for key exchange, enabling secure communication between two parties by establishing a shared secret key. On the other hand, RSA (Rivest-Shamir-Adleman) is an asymmetric encryption algorithm used for both encryption and digital signatures.

In RSA, each party possesses a pair of mathematically related keys: a public key for encryption and a private key for decryption or signature generation. The public key can be openly shared with others, while the private key must be kept secret. It allows secure communication between any two parties without requiring a pre-existing shared secret.

In summary, the purpose of the Diffie-Hellman protocol is to establish a shared secret key over an insecure channel using modular exponentiation and the discrete logarithm problem. The main difference between RSA and Diffie-Hellman lies in their applications: Diffie-Hellman is a key exchange protocol, while RSA is an asymmetric encryption algorithm used for encryption and digital signatures. Both protocols have distinct roles in modern cryptographic systems and contribute to ensuring secure communication and data protection.

This question has been answered.

Get Answer
PLACE AN ORDER NOW

Compute Cost of Paper

Subject:
Type:
Pages/Words:
Single spaced
approx 275 words per page
Urgency:
Level:
Currency:
Total Cost:

Our Services

image

  • Research Paper Writing
  • Essay Writing
  • Dissertation Writing
  • Thesis Writing

Why Choose Us

image

  • Money Return guarantee
  • Guaranteed Privacy
  • Written by Professionals
  • Paper Written from Scratch
  • Timely Deliveries
  • Free Amendments